Definition & Meaning
The most common meaning of FTM is Female to Male. This abbreviation is widely used within transgender communities and refers to a person who was assigned female at birth but identifies and lives as male.
For many people, FTM serves as a simple way to describe their gender identity or transition journey.
It is commonly used in online discussions, support groups, social media profiles, and educational content about transgender experiences.
Example
Person A: “How long have you been transitioning?”
Person B: “I’m FTM and started my transition two years ago.”
In this example, FTM clearly means Female to Male.
Other Meanings of FTM
Although Female to Male is the most recognized meaning, FTM can also stand for other phrases depending on the context.
Some alternative meanings include:
- First Time Mom
- Full Time Mom
- For The Money
- Follow The Money
- Field Training Manual
- First Time Mother
Example in Parenting Groups
Parent A: “Any advice for newborn sleep schedules?”
Parent B: “I’m an FTM too, and I’m still learning.”
Here, FTM means First Time Mom, not Female to Male.
Why Context Matters
Because FTM has several meanings, context is essential. The same abbreviation may mean one thing in a parenting forum and something completely different on a social media profile.
For example:
- In LGBTQ+ discussions > Female to Male.
- In parenting communities > First Time Mom.
- In business discussions > Follow The Money.
- In training programs > Field Training Manual.
This is why reading the surrounding conversation is important before making assumptions.

Background & History
The abbreviation FTM has existed for many years, but its popularity increased significantly with the growth of online communities and social media platforms.
Origins in Transgender Communities
The term Female to Male became widely used during the late twentieth century as transgender advocacy and support groups expanded.
People needed a short and clear way to describe gender transitions.
Abbreviations such as:
- FTM (Female to Male)
became common in support groups, online forums, educational materials, and healthcare discussions.
Growth Through the Internet
The internet played a major role in spreading the term. During the early days of online forums and chat rooms, people frequently used abbreviations to save time while typing.
As transgender communities became more visible online, FTM became a standard shorthand term.
Adoption by Other Communities
Over time, the abbreviation was adopted by completely different groups.
For example:
- Parenting communities used it to mean First Time Mom.
- Business professionals used it to mean Follow The Money.
- Military and law enforcement settings sometimes used it to mean Field Training Manual.
This expansion created multiple meanings for the same abbreviation.

Comparison with Similar Terms
Understanding related terms helps avoid confusion.
| Term | Meaning | Main Use |
| FTM | Female to Male | Gender identity |
| MTF | Male to Female | Gender identity |
| AFAB | Assigned Female at Birth | Birth assignment |
| AMAB | Assigned Male at Birth | Birth assignment |
| NB | Non-Binary | Gender identity |
| Cisgender | Gender aligns with birth assignment | Identity description |
Key Difference
FTM specifically refers to a person transitioning or identifying from female assignment at birth to male identity.
AFAB only describes birth assignment and does not necessarily indicate gender identity.
